Sharks confirm Bok signing

The Sharks on Monday finally confirmed reports, which first surfaced last week, that they have signed Griquas' Springbok tighthead prop Lourens Adriaanse on a two-year deal.

Adriaanse, who is currently with the Bok in Argentina ahead of the second round of the Rugby Championship, will officially join the Sharks in November.

He will participate in the Sharks' pre-season training ahead of the start of the Super Rugby tournament in 2014.

Confirming the signing, Sharks Commercial Manager Rudolf Straeuli said they have been impressed with Adriaanse's performances for both the Cheetahs in Super Rugby and Griquas in the Currie Cup competition.

"He has a good workrate around the park and will add depth to our tight five," Straeuli said.

Sharks CEO John Smit also welcomed the news.

"Lourens has displayed his immense potential and value as a tighthead prop and is a good addition to our squad," Smit said.

"We look forward to welcoming him to The Sharks family."
